Thulium-doped fiber amplifier for optical communications at 2 µm.
We report the first experimental realization and detailed characterization of thulium doped fiber amplifiers (TDFAs) specifically designed for optical communications providing high gain (>35 dB), noise figure as low as 5 dB, and over 100 nm wide bandwidth around 2 µm. A maximum saturated output power of 1.2 W was achieved with a slope efficiency of 50%. The gain dynamics of the amplifier were a...

متن کامل50-W 2-μm Nanosecond All-Fiber-Based Thulium-Doped Fiber Amplifier
We report a two-stage 2-μm Tm3+ fiber amplifier seeded by an acousto-optic modulator (AOM) modulated narrowbandwidth pulsed laser. Maximum output average power is over 50 W (slope efficiency of ∼58%) at 50 kHz repetition rate, providing record performance in nanosecond 2-μm all-fiber-based amplifiers. The maximum pulse energy and peak power are ∼1.0 mJ and 10 kW, respectively. The pulse width c...
